Pro Tips for Making Stunning Cookie Bags
Let’s ensure your cookie bags stand out! Here are some expert insights:
- Choose the Right Size: Ensure your bag or box fits your cookies snugly to prevent shifting during transport.
- Use Clear Windows: If using boxes, consider ones with clear windows for a peek at your delicious treats.
- Seal for Freshness: Use heat sealers or stickers to keep cookies fresh inside their packaging.
- Add Personal Touches: Incorporate ribbons, tags, or stickers to personalize your bags for special occasions.
- Keep it Simple: Sometimes, less is more. A simple, elegant design can be incredibly effective.
- Test Before Finalizing: Create a few prototypes before making a large order to ensure everything looks and functions as you want.
- Consider Your Audience: Tailor your packaging design to the preferences of your target customers or event attendees.
- Utilize Natural Elements: Incorporate elements like twine or dried flowers for a charming, rustic appearance.
Common Mistakes to Avoid
Even the best bakers can run into issues. Here are some common mistakes to watch out for:
- Neglecting Durability: Make sure your packaging can handle the weight and texture of your cookies without tearing.
- Ignoring Presentation: Don’t forget that presentation matters! Invest time in making your packaging look appealing.
- Overcomplicating Designs: Sometimes, a simple design is more effective than an overly complex one.
- Not Considering Shelf Life: Ensure your packaging keeps cookies fresh for as long as you need, especially if selling.

Frequently Asked Questions
Here are some common questions and answers to help you:
- What materials are best for cookie bags? Eco-friendly options like kraft paper and biodegradable materials are excellent choices.
- Can I customize my cookie bags? Absolutely! You can personalize them with designs, colors, and sizes that reflect your style.
- How long do cookies stay fresh in packaged bags? Typically, cookies can stay fresh for about 1-2 weeks if stored properly.
- Is it necessary to use a seal? Using a seal can help keep cookies fresh longer, especially if they contain moist ingredients.
- Can I use plastic bags for cookies? While plastic bags are convenient, consider eco-friendly options for sustainability.
- What’s the best way to present cookie bags for gifts? Adding personal touches like handwritten notes or decorative ribbons makes them special.
- Are there size options for cookie boxes? Yes! There are many sizes available to suit your cookie type and quantity.
- How can I ensure my packaging is eco-friendly? Look for certifications or labels that indicate the materials are biodegradable or recyclable.
